Every cooling system includes an evaporator coil. The coil circulates refrigerant throughout a loop, which is what cools the air that moves through the rooms in your Guyton, Georgia, office or home. If your evaporator coil begins to leakage, it’s easy to stress and not understand what to do. However with the aid of a HVAC professional and a fast response to the issue, you can get your evaporator coil up and running in no time.

However when you utilize cleaning products, aerosol air fresheners, adhesives for craft jobs, and other chemicals in your house, they often include unpredictable organic compounds (VOCs). As VOCs integrate with wetness in the air, they can produce acids that form little pinhole leaks in the coil. These small holes, also referred to as “formicary tunneling corrosion,” permit air from the outdoors into your home.

The issue that numerous homeowner deal with is understanding whether they have refrigerant leaks. The holes in the copper coil are very little, so they’re hard to find just by looking at the component. Your evaporator coil also isn’t right away visible to somebody looking at the HEATING AND COOLING system, so a leakage requires diagnosis by a skilled A/C specialist.

If your cooling system takes a very long time to cool your home down, this is a sign that you may have a refrigerant leakage.

It might not have the ability to keep up, resulting in warm and unpleasant temperature levels throughout interior areas. When you switch on your ac system or lower the thermostat, the cooling system need to kick on instantly to begin blowing cold air through the vents. If the air flow feels weak or doesn’t turn on best away, you might have a refrigerant leak.

These indications might suggest other problems with the cooling system, however having warm air come out of your vents when the cooling system is on is never a great sign. If you do have this take place, turn off your system and call a HVAC professional to check. Keeping the system on may trigger additional damage.

However this isn’t like the gasoline in your vehicle that gets consumed through regular use. A cooling system won’t run out of refrigerant, unless it has a leak. It cycles the very same refrigerant to cool the air as required. So if you have actually worked with HEATING AND COOLING professionals in the past who inform you that the system just needs to be refilled, that is inaccurate.

Regular maintenance of your A/C system is likewise important to make sure it’s in good condition. Altering the filters monthly will keep the air moving effectively while filtering dirt, dust, family pet hair, dander, pollen, and other particles out of the system.

Throughout your regular maintenance service, the service technician can also inspect and clean the evaporator coil with a service that will get rid of dirt and dust and neutralize acid that forms and triggers the leaks. A tidy coil can move heat more efficiently, which means that the system will not need to remain on as long to cool the air.

So keeping your system running as effectively as possible can assist lower the risk of a refrigerant leakage. Having your air ducts cleared out will also assist in enhancing the effectiveness of your cooling and heating system. When dust, pollen, dirt, and other particles develop within the ducts, the system has to work more difficult to move the air to different parts of the office or home.

Routine duct cleaning is helpful since it assists to extend the life of different components of your cooling system, improves effectiveness, and keeps much better air quality, so you can breathe easier.
